Bill Summary
The State Capitol Joint Management Commission was created to maintain the House Complex, consisting of the State House and the State House Annex. The complex is home to the New Jersey Legislature and all its members and employees. Executive officials, because of the COVID-19 pandemic and ongoing construction to the State House, have not utilized the House Complex to the same extent as the Legislature. In order to more appropriately balance decision-making authority regarding management and maintenance of the House Complex, this bill changes the composition of the commission. This bill increases the legislative representation in the commission, with two members each being appointed by the President of the Senate, the Speaker of the General Assembly, the Minority Leader of the Senate, and the Minority Leader of the General Assembly. Additionally, the executive members of the commission, the Director of the Division of Budget and Accounting, the General Services Administrator and two members appointed by the Governor, will become non-voting members of the commission.
